UO_2燃料芯块的总氢量(氢、水等)的测定是核燃料元件生产中一项十分重要的质量检验。本文介绍用高温真空析出UO_2芯块中的氢、水和碳氢化合物气体,借助于700℃的铀还原炉还原出水和碳氢化合物中的氢,用质谱计测定总的氢量。投样器确保了芯块中的水份全部纳入总氢结果。用已知水含量的UO_2芯块测的回收率为91~104%,检测灵敏度为0.2ppm,实验误差分析表明:测定结果的准确度好于±15%。
Determination of the total hydrogen content (hydrogen, water, etc.) of UO_2 fuel pellets is a very important quality test in the production of nuclear fuel components. In this paper, hydrogen, water and hydrocarbon gas in UO 2 pellets are precipitated by high temperature vacuum. The hydrogen in effluent and hydrocarbon is reduced by means of uranium reduction furnace at 700 ℃. The total hydrogen content is measured by mass spectrometer. The injector ensures that the moisture in the pellets is fully incorporated into the total hydrogen results. The recovery of UO 2 pellets with known water content was 91 ~ 104% and the detection sensitivity was 0.2ppm. The experimental error analysis showed that the accuracy of the determination was better than ± 15%.
